THIS IS REACT 14 BRANCH, IT IS STABLE AND READY FOR PROD.
The goal of this fork is to run React applications on Internet Explorer Mobile 6/7 running on Windows CE 6/7 (used on some embedded devices, like MC31/MC32 hand scanners).
This is the fork of React 0.14.x that is working on IE6/7.
The test application is working well and much faster and stable on IE 6/7 than 16.6.x forked version: https://github.com/sormy/react-oldie/tree/16-dev-ie

Build artifacts of this package can't be used on IE 6/7 without transpilation.
I got it working using rollup + babel + polyfills + some minor patches. You could see
a working example in example-oldie
directory.
Full ES3 support is available in babel@7
using @babel/preset-env
since v7.4.3
.
module.exports = {
presets: [
// transform-function-name is breaking React 0.14.x: '_renderedComponent' is null or not an object
// generators are not supported on IE7, use fast-async instead in default promises mode
["@babel/preset-env", {
targets: ["IE 7"],
loose: true, /* es3 */
exclude: [
"transform-function-name",
"transform-regenerator",
"transform-async-to-generator"
]
}],
["@babel/preset-react", { development: false }],
"@babel/preset-typescript"
],
plugins: [
["@babel/plugin-proposal-class-properties", { loose: true /* es3 */ }],
["@babel/plugin-proposal-object-rest-spread", { loose: true /* es3 */ }],
// Adds support for async/await using Promises
"module:fast-async",
// Adds React component name that helps debugging on minified builds
"babel-plugin-add-react-displayname",
// Replaces process.env.NODE_ENV during build time
"babel-plugin-transform-inline-environment-variables",
// Strip PropTypes to improve performance in production
"babel-plugin-transform-react-remove-prop-types",
// React optimizations to improve performance in production
"@babel/plugin-transform-react-constant-elements",
"@babel/plugin-transform-react-inline-elements",
]
}
Recommended Polyfills:
- console stub
- stub error classes (used by es5-shim / es5-sham):
window.EvalError = window.Error
window.InternalError = window.Error
window.RangeError = window.Error
window.ReferenceError = window.Error
window.SyntaxError = window.Error
window.TypeError = window.Error
window.URIError = window.Error
es5-shim
(es5-shim / es5-sham)core-js
for some stuffpromise-polyfill
(optional)json3
polyfill (optional)typedarray
polyfill (optional)setimmediate-modular
polyfill (optional)requestAnimationFrame()
polyfill (optional)
Rollup configuration:
freeze: false
Other issues that needs minor patching:
- rollup-plugin-commonjs: rollup/rollup-plugin-commonjs#364
- babel: babel/babel#9226 (just for babel-plugin-transform-react-constant-elements)
UglifyJS configuration:
{
ie8: true,
mangle: {
keep_fnames: true
}
}
